I am currently in the situation that if I run the update manager I get an update for the update manager (version 1:0.8.0 to 1:0.8.1). The issue is that this item is not selectable. I cannot update it. There might be some reason for this but I can not seem to find out what it is and I can imagine it as being confusing for others as well as for me.
FredB
October 13th, 2007, 12:14 PM
I suppose you're using an AMD64 gutsy ?
Because package is not build right now.
See bug here :
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/update-manager/+bug/152338
And also, follow the package build process here :
https://laun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/update-manager/1:0.81/
If you're not using an AMD64 version, your mirror, is not up-to-date ;)
